One example from Part II of Nordhaus' book Climate Casino that illustrates a change in price or quantity in a market is the case of renewable energy.
A.) In recent years, there has been an increase in demand for renewable energy sources. This change in demand can be attributed to various factors. Firstly, there has been a growing concern about climate change and the environmental impacts of fossil fuel-based energy sources. This has led to a shift in preferences towards cleaner and more sustainable energy alternatives. Additionally, government policies and regulations aimed at promoting renewable energy, such as subsidies and incentives, have contributed to the increase in demand. As a result, there has been an upward shift in the demand curve for renewable energy.
B.) Simultaneously, there has been an increase in the supply of renewable energy. Advances in technology, such as improvements in solar and wind power generation, have made renewable energy sources more economically viable. This has led to a decrease in the costs of materials and inputs required for renewable energy production. Furthermore, government support and investment in renewable energy infrastructure have increased the number of firms operating in the market. These factors have resulted in an outward shift of the supply curve for renewable energy.
Additionally, the quantity of renewable energy generated and consumed has increased substantially, as more consumers and businesses are opting for cleaner energy options. This example showcases the interplay between demand and supply factors that influence market dynamics and the transition towards more sustainable energy sources.

K owns a Whole life policy. If K wants an increasing death benefit to protect against inflation, which dividend option would she chose?
K would choose the Paid-Up Additions (PUA) dividend option to achieve an increasing death benefit to protect against inflation in her Whole life policy.
If K wants an increasing death benefit to protect against inflation in her Whole life policy, she would choose the Paid-Up Additions (PUA) dividend option.
The Paid-Up Additions (PUA) dividend option allows the policyholder to use the dividends received from the insurance company to purchase additional paid-up life insurance coverage. This additional coverage is added to the base policy and increases the death benefit.
By selecting the PUA option, K can effectively enhance her death benefit over time. As the dividends are used to purchase additional coverage, the death benefit will increase, providing better protection against inflation and ensuring that the policy's value keeps pace with rising costs.
The advantage of the PUA option is that it allows K to allocate the dividends she receives from the insurance company back into her policy, which increases the overall cash value and death benefit.
This feature helps to maintain the policy's purchasing power and provides a hedge against the erosion of the death benefit's real value due to inflation.
In summary, by choosing the Paid-Up Additions (PUA) dividend option, K can achieve an increasing death benefit that protects against inflation by using the dividends to purchase additional paid-up life insurance coverage.

Define (a) sensitivity analysis, (b) scenario analysis, and (c) simulation analysis. If GE were considering two projects (one for $500 million to develop a satellite communications system and the other for$30,000 for a new truck), on which would the company be more likely to use a simulation analysis?
Given the large investment and complexity of the satellite communications system project, GE would be more likely to use a simulation analysis to test different scenarios and variables to help make informed decisions.
On the other hand, the investment in the new truck project is relatively small, and the decision may not require a sophisticated analysis technique like simulation analysis.
a) Sensitivity analysis is a technique used to identify the relationship between variables in a model and to measure the effect of changes in one or more variables on the outcome of the model. It involves analyzing how sensitive the results of a model are to changes in certain variables.
b) Scenario analysis involves analyzing how a particular model will perform under different possible scenarios. It typically involves creating different scenarios by adjusting key variables in a model and analyzing the resulting outcomes.
c) Simulation analysis involves creating a computer model to simulate a real-world situation and testing how different variables affect the outcome of the situation. It can involve creating multiple simulations to test different scenarios and analyzing the results.

SFAS No. 123 was issued as a compromise to the FASB's original position regarding stock options as it allowed companies to choose either the APB No. 25 intrinsic value method or to expense the fair value of the options.T/F?
True. SFAS No. 123, issued by the Financial Accounting Standards Board (FASB), allowed companies to choose between the APB No. 25 intrinsic value method or expensing the fair value of stock options. This decision was made as a compromise to the FASB's original position on stock options.
SFAS No. 123, or Statement of Financial Accounting Standards No. 123, was issued by the FASB in response to the controversy surrounding the accounting treatment of stock options. The FASB initially proposed that stock options should be expensed at their fair value, which was met with resistance from companies and some stakeholders.
To reach a compromise, SFAS No. 123 allowed companies the choice of either using the intrinsic value method prescribed by APB No. 25 or expensing the fair value of stock options. The intrinsic value method calculates the value of stock options based on the difference between the market price of the stock and the exercise price of the options. On the other hand, expensing the fair value method recognizes the options as an expense on the company's income statement based on the estimated fair value of the options at the time of grant.
While SFAS No. 123 initially provided companies with flexibility in their accounting treatment of stock options, subsequent accounting standards (such as SFAS No. 123R and ASC 718) mandated the fair value method for expensing stock options. This change was aimed at enhancing transparency and aligning financial reporting with the economic reality of stock-based compensation.
